Firstly we’ve made some enhancements to the Conversations experience in Plannr! Following feedback from users around our Conversations functionality in Plannr, we’ve undertaken some work to improve the experience for clients and your teams.

From the client’s perspective, starting a new conversation with their advice team offers much more clarity on who the message will be delivered to, along with the title block and message description now being in the same pop out window. No more long messages being sent in the title field!

If there isn’t anyone in the ‘assigned team’ in your Update Basic Details > Service tab then the message will show as being sent to the ‘team at your firm who looks after you’.

For accessibility purposes, messages are now displayed in clear to read colour / contrast blocks:

From the adviser portal perspective, if the conversation doesn’t warrant all members of the team being in the discussion, it’s simple to remove individuals by clicking on the participants icon. Useful if it’s something the admin team can deal with without needing adviser input. Equally other employees can be added, or the client’s partner, if the conversation needs opening up to more participants.

Starting a new thread in the adviser portal follows the same updated view, with the message recipients, title and content available in one screen.

Next up we have improvements to recording your risk scores in Plannr!

Where the risk profiling is completed off-Plannr and a score needs recording against a client record, we would historically just capture the individual’s rating along with a time horizon.

Now, you can add additional information where a risk score is being logged, but may not necessarily match the outcome of an ATR questionnaire.

Along with some additional improvements to the data capture, you now have a clearer at-a-glance view of current risk ratings within the Work area of your client record.
